DEAN'S DISCRETIONARY FUND

The Dean’s Discretionary Fund was established through a grant from the William and Flora Hewlett Foundation. A portion of the income from this fund will be devoted to the general purpose of faculty development. In the past, this fund was utilized in a variety of ways including support for faculty to attend and present papers at professional conferences, for lectures, and for research support, among others. Approximately, $25,000 will be allocated for these purposes in each year. This amount is in addition to the annual allowance granted each faculty member.

The guidelines applicable to the distribution of these funds are as follows:

PERSONS ELIGIBLE: Members of the Executive Faculty.

PURPOSE: Eligible uses of the fund include professional travel (for conferences, workshops, etc.), research assistance, and other professional development expenses. All expenditures should be made according to University guidelines.

APPLICATION: Faculty members should submit a memorandum to the Dean identifying the purpose and justification for the professional development activity and the amount required. Normally, priority of support for professional travel will be given to faculty who present papers, organize panels, or act as discussants at conferences and workshops. If a faculty member has access to other sponsored program funds (soft money), those funds should be exhausted before requesting support from the faculty development fund.

TIMING: Requests should be submitted before the end of September for allocation during the academic year. A small amount will be reserved for unplanned activities that occur during the second semester.
